I've been trying for awhile to get some love from GE Capital. I have two of their cards (Walmart and JCP). I opened them in Aug/Sept of last year. The reasons that they keep giving me are -
Serious delinquency and public record or collection filed (maybe my tax liens?)
Time since derogatory public report of collections is to short (last baddy was almost 4 years ago. That's when my BK was finalized)
Proportion of loan balances to amount amounts is to high (utilization was in the 20% range when I requested before)
Length of time revolving accounts have been established (I had them for over a year the last time I requested an increase)
Well, I was checking my accounts today and saw that they doubled my limit. That sounds great but I had a $200. limit before and now it's at $400. I guess it's a start. I've been using the card a lot over the last few weeks so I could get the additional discount. So I'd use it then pay it off a few days later then use it again. Don't know if that helped or not but maybe it's a start of them loosening up a little with me. Oh, and my scores are pretty much in the same range as they were when I requested an increase a few months ago. Maybe about 10-15 points lower because of Cap1 not closing my statement when they were suppose to so I didn't get to pay off the balance before that happened.
